490 likes | 579 Views
Internet Protocol versão 6. Índice. Introdução Objetivos e Benefícios Formatação de Endereço Tipos de Endereços Cabeçalho IPv6 Operações básicas do IPv6 1 o Teste. 1 a Fase Aparecimento da ARPANET Rede Militar Domínio EUA. Introdução. Rede privada.
E N D
Índice • Introdução • Objetivos e Benefícios • Formatação de Endereço • Tipos de Endereços • CabeçalhoIPv6 • Operações básicas do IPv6 • 1o Teste
1a Fase • Aparecimento da ARPANET • Rede Militar • Domínio EUA Introdução Redeprivada • Evolução paraInternet • Rede Acadêmica • Domínio EUA Centenasdehosts IPv4 • Internet Comercial • Rede Universal • DomínioMundial 4 milhões de hosts
Introdução • 1a Fase • 1991 - 1a barreira de crescimento • Crescimento exponencial da Internet • Tamanho das tabelas de roteamento • Exaustão dos endereços IP’s até 1994 2a Fase
Introdução 2a Fase
Introdução • 2a Fase • Criação do CIDR - Classless Inter-Domain Routing • NAT – Network Address Translation • 2a barreira para o crescimento • Integração dos serviços de voz ao de dados • Necessidade de QoS para pacotes multimídia • Necessidade de endereços IP globais • Auto-configuração IPv6
3a Fase Introdução Large Address Space Integração de Serviços IPv6 Auto-Configuration Enhanced Mobility
Objetivos • Espaço de endereços de 32 para 128 bits • Cabeçalho simplificado • Arquitetura hierárquica de rede • Compatibilidade com protocolos de roteamento • Auto-configuração • Eliminação do NAT • Suporte à QoS • Crescimento do no de endereços Multicast
Formatação de Endereço • Aumento da quantidade de Endereços globais • 4 bilhões 3,4x1038 • 1030 IP’s por pessoa no planeta
Formatação de Endereço • Nova Notação • Endereço de 16 bytes • b.b.b.b.b.b.b.b.b.b.b.b.b.b.b.b • Divididos em 8 grupos de 4 Hexadecimais • hhhh:hhhh:hhhh:hhhh:hhhh:hhhh:hhhh:hhhh
Formatação de Endereço Exemplo 8000:0000:0000:0000:0123:0000:89AB:CDEF Zeros podem ser simplificados 8000::123:0000:89AB:CDEF Porém só uma vez 8000::0123::89AB:CDEF
Formatação de Endereço Representação para Ambientes Mistos x:x:x:x:x:x:d.d.d.d Exemplo 0:0:0:0:0:0:152.84.50.35 Na forma abreviada ::152.84.50.35
Formatação de Endereço Outra notação importante end/prefixo 12AB:0:0:CD30:0:0:0:0/60 ou 12AB::CD30:0:0:0:0/60 ou 12AB:0:0:CD30::/60 Neste caso os 60 primeiros bits são de rede e os outros 68 bits são de interface
Tipos de Endereços • Existem 3 tipos de Endereços: • Unicast • Anycast • Multicast Não existe endereço Broadcast
Tipos de Endereços Endereço Unicast • AgregatableGlobal unicast • Site-local unicast • Link-local unicast • IPv4-compatible IPv6 • IPv4-mapped IPv6 • Loopback • Unspecifield
Tipos de Endereços Agregatable Global unicast
Tipos de Endereços Agregatable Global unicast • TLA(Top Level Aggregator) - utilizado para identificar ISP's de topo • RES- reservado para suportar o crescimento de TLA's e NLA's. Sempre igual a "0“ • NLA's(Next Level Aggregator) - utilizado para identificar ISP's intermédios • SLA(Site Level Aggregator) - utilizado por empresas de modo a possibilitar uma utilização semelhante as subnets no IPv4 • Interface Identifier- utilizado para identificar interfaces
Tipos de Endereços Site-local unicast
Tipos de Endereços Link-local unicast
Tipos de Endereços IPv4-compatible IPv6
Tipos de Endereços IPv4-mapped IPv6
Tipos de Endereços Loopback Address • Representado por 0:0:0:0:0:0:0:1 ou "::1" • Endereço de Loopback de qualquer interface
Tipos de Endereços Unspecifield Address • Representado por 0:0:0:0:0:0:0:0 ou "::“ • Indica a ausência de um endereço • Utilizado como "source address" de hosts que não tenham obtido o seu próprio endereçamento
Tipos de Endereços Endereço Anycast • Utilizado para identificar um grupo de interfaces pertencentes a nós diferentes • O pacote é enviado para a interface mais próximo de acordo com o protocolo de roteamento • Este tipo de endereçamento será útil na detecção rápida de um determinado servidor ou serviço
Tipos de Endereços Endereço Anycast
Tipos de Endereços Endereço Multicast
Tipos de Endereços Endereço Multicast • Nós Ipv6 recebem pacotes destinados aos grupos: • FF02::1 – todos os nós (link-local scope) • FF02::2 - todos os Roteadores (link-local scope) • FF05::2 – todos os Roteadores (site-local scope) • FF02::1:FFXX:XXXX/104 - Solicited-Node multicast address
Tipos de Endereços Solicited-Node multicast address • Possui o prefixo FF02:0:0:0:0:1:FF00:0000/104 • Concatenado com últimos 24 bits do endereço unicast ou anycast
Tipos de Endereços Solicited-Node multicast address • Exemplo • O endereço solicited-node correspondente ao endereço IPv6: • 2001::01:800:200E:8C6C FF02::1:FF0E:8C6C • Este tipo de endereçamento é utilizado nas mensagens de solicitação de vizinhança de rede.
Cabeçalho IPv6 Comparação IPv4 - IPv6
Cabeçalho IPv6 Extention Header
Operaçõesbásicas • Agregação de Prefixo • NeighborDiscovery • RouterDiscovery • Auto-configuração
Operaçõesbásicas Agregação de Prefixo • Permite estabelecer um tipo de endereçamento hierárquico • Exemplo • um ISP pode dividir o seu prefixo pelos seus clientes agregando-os quando os anuncia na Internet
Operaçõesbásicas Neighbor Discovery
Operaçõesbásicas Router Discovery
Operaçõesbásicas Auto-configuração
Operaçõesbásicas Outros Serviços • Segurança - IPSec • Autenticação de cabeçalho • Encapsulamento IP encryptado • Suporte à serviços em tempo real • Aplicações Multimídia • Integração de dados, voz e video • Suporte a Mutiprotocolos • 3a Geração da telefonia móvel
no CBPF Objetivos • Estudar o novo Protocolo • Testes no Laboratório da CAT • Projeto 6Bone da RNP • Implementação no CBPF • Implementação na Rede Rio
no CBPF Equipamentos com Suporte IPv6 • Hosts • Linux • SUN – Solaris 2.8 • Windows - 2000, XP, 98* • Routers • cisco 2500 • cisco 4500 • cisco 7513 • cisco 7200
no CBPF Pontos positivos • Associação a um projeto Mundial – 6Bone • Preparação para o Futuro • Custo zero • Utilização de QoS e IPSec
no CBPF • Laboratório • teste IPv4 152.84.0.2 152.84.0.1 2003::/64 Tunel IPv6 2001::/64 IPv6 IPv6